Talent.com
Senior Software Developer (GCPay)
Senior Software Developer (GCPay)Autodesk • Vancouver, BC, CAN
Senior Software Developer (GCPay)

Senior Software Developer (GCPay)

Autodesk • Vancouver, BC, CAN
Il y a plus de 30 jours
Type de contrat
  • Temps plein
  • Télétravail
Description de poste

Position Overview


Autodesk’s Payment Solutions suite is powered by GCPay, an intuitive application that automates and streamlines the payment application process between General Contractors and Subcontractors. As a Full-Stack Senior Software Developer on the GCPay team, you will be responsible for the care and growth of this Payment platform’s web applications, ERP integrations, and many other tools, including implementing new features either for end-users or data consumers (internal or external), architecting integrating new functionality from Autodesk’s shared platforms, crafting APIs, designing and tuning data models and collections, writing tests and documentation, improving, automating and managing the operations to the different technology stacks. Be the go-to person in the org for various web apps, ERPs, and more. Work on solving complex technical challenges and demonstrate ownership throughout projects.

Primary technology stack: Java, MySQL, ElasticSearch, and AWS Cloud technologies.

This is a fully remote position based in Canada, with a preference for Pacific and Central Time Zones.


Responsibilities

  • Design, code, test, debug, and document new and existing functional components to ensure that software meets business, quality, and operational needs

  • Break apart complex initiatives into manageable chunks. Document these along with architectural decisions and code design specifications

  • Focus on quality, including writing unit/integration tests and refactoring when appropriate, debug, and solve defects in implemented software solutions

  • Participate in on-call responsibilities and relevant tasks, demonstrate strong leadership in incident calls, driving the investigation, timely resolution, and improvements required for each incident.

  • Collaborate and communicate effectively with your leads, Product Managers, DevOps, SDETs, and Software Developers

  • Work within a small, agile team, following a sprint methodology

  • Participate actively in code reviews and contribute to technical discussions

  • Advanced expert role, requiring deep subject-matter knowledge and sound business acumen to advise leaders

  • Understand and become an SME on ERPs, web apps, and related systems

  • Require depth of specialized expertise, technical and non-technical, to interpret internal/external business issues and recommend best practices, performant solutions to address them

  • Candidates who pay close attention to detail may choose to include the word Keystone in their introduction and talk about an example where they owned a complex or difficult situation

  • Solve complex problems that require in-depth evaluation of variable factors by taking a broad perspective to identify the best approach and innovative solutions

  • Effectively communicate technical challenges within and across teams

  • Keep yourself up-to-date with evolving technologies and showcase them with an implementation

Minimum Qualifications

  • 5+ years of experience in developing enterprise applications

  • Expertise in Java, Spring Boot, JavaScript, React, and REST APIs

  • Hands-on experience with Amazon Web Services

  • MySQL or similar database expertise

  • Experience in building, running, and monitoring SaaS applications at a large scale

  • Working knowledge of Software design patterns, distributed systems, resiliency, infra, and security

Preferred Qualifications

  • Knowledge of ERP systems, event-driven architecture, and payment platforms

  • Elasticsearch or similar search technology background, especially building new indexes or queries for production systems

  • Familiar with virtual computing pipeline stages, e.g. building (GitHub, Docker), testing and deploying (Jenkins, CI/CD, Kubernetes), hosted runtimes (AWS, Elasticsearch), etc

Learn MoreAbout AutodeskWelcome to Autodesk! Amazing things are created every day with our software – from the greenest buildings and cleanest cars to the smartest factories and biggest hit movies. We help innovators turn their ideas into reality, transforming not only how things are made, but what can be made.We take great pride in our culture here at Autodesk – it’s at the core of everything we do. Our culture guides the way we work and treat each other, informs how we connect with customers and partners, and defines how we show up in the world.When you’re an Autodesker, you can do meaningful work that helps build a better world designed and made for all. Ready to shape the world and your future? Join us!Salary transparencySalary is one part of Autodesk’s competitive compensation package. For Canada-BC based roles, we expect a starting base salary between $98,600 and $144,650. Offers are based on the candidate’s experience and geographic location, and may exceed this range. In addition to base salaries, our compensation package may include annual cash bonuses, commissions for sales roles, stock grants, and a comprehensive benefits package.Diversity & Belonging
We take pride in cultivating a culture of belonging where everyone can thrive. Learn more here: Are you an existing contractor or consultant with Autodesk? Please search for open jobs and apply internally (not on this external site).
Créer une alerte emploi pour cette recherche

Senior Software Developer GCPay • Vancouver, BC, CAN

Offres similaires
General Application

General Application

Carbon Engineering Ltd. • Squamish, BC, CA
Temps plein
Quick Apply
Leading the commercialization of ground-breaking technology that captures CO₂ directly from air is challenging and exhilarating.As a member of the CE team, you’ll be surrounded by smart, adventurou...Voir plus
Dernière mise à jour : il y a plus de 30 jours
Management Development Program - BC Plumbing

Management Development Program - BC Plumbing

EMCO Corporation • Squamish
Temps plein
Management Development Program - BC Plumbing.We are currently hiring full time Management Development Program Trainees.This is a full-time, salaried position with a comprehensive benefits package a...Voir plus
Dernière mise à jour : il y a 3 jours • Offre sponsorisée
Senior Software Development Engineer in Test(SDET) PDF Solutions

Senior Software Development Engineer in Test(SDET) PDF Solutions

Semiconductor Engineering • Vancouver
Temps plein
We are seeking a senior test automation developer with deep expertise in backend and frontend test automation to lead the design, implementation, and maintenance of robust, scalable, and maintainab...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Senior Enterprise AE — Data-Driven Software, Hybrid

Senior Enterprise AE — Data-Driven Software, Hybrid

BlueOptima • Vancouver
Temps plein
A technology solutions provider in Vancouver is seeking a Senior Account Executive to join their Sales Team.The role involves delivering revenue by working with enterprise customers and the SDR tea...Voir plus
Dernière mise à jour : il y a 3 jours • Offre sponsorisée
Team Lead, Software Development — IoT, Data-Driven Growth

Team Lead, Software Development — IoT, Data-Driven Growth

Semios • Vancouver
Temps plein
A leading agriculture technology company in Vancouver is seeking a Team Lead for Software Development to manage and grow a skilled team while delivering high-quality products.The ideal candidate ha...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Senior Backend Developer

Senior Backend Developer

Creator.co • Vancouver
Temps plein
Looking for your next big opportunity in product development? Say hello to Creator, we connect brands of all sizes with influencers worldwide through our software platform and deliver social media ...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Technical Lead - Remote

Technical Lead - Remote

Anime Universe • Richmond, Canada, CA
Télétravail
Temps plein
Equity Partner –Location: Remote (Canada) Jurisdiction: Global Minimum commitment: 20 hours per week Reports To: IT leadOverviewA Technical Lead provides technical direction and oversight for softw...Voir plus
Dernière mise à jour : il y a 1 jour • Offre sponsorisée
Third Engineer

Third Engineer

Bridgemans Services • Squamish
Temps plein
Primary Location: On MV Isabelle X/ Saga-Company Vessels alongside Squamish, BC.Company Operating Name: Bridgemans Crew Management Ltd.Business Address: 2512 Yukon St, Vancouver, BC V5Y 0H2.Terms o...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
APPLY NOW! Public Works and Maintenance Labourers NOC 75212 Jobd In-Demand

APPLY NOW! Public Works and Maintenance Labourers NOC 75212 Jobd In-Demand

GTR Worldwide India • Squamish, BC, ca
Temps plein +1
Quick Apply
Clean and maintain sidewalks, streets, roads and public grounds of municipality and other areas, working as member of crew.Sweep debris and remove snow from streets, sidewalks, building grounds and...Voir plus
Dernière mise à jour : il y a 2 jours
Construction Project Manager – Custom Residential

Construction Project Manager – Custom Residential

CVC Custom Builders • Squamish, BC, CAN
Temps plein
Quick Apply
Construction Project Manager - Custom Residential.Commute to Whistler, BC (Required) | Full-Time | On-Site.Deliver an Exceptional Experience.CVC Custom Builders is a respected luxury residential co...Voir plus
Dernière mise à jour : il y a plus de 30 jours
Full Time Finance Manager

Full Time Finance Manager

Squamish Toyota • Squamish
Temps plein
Squamish Toyota is a well-established dealership with a strong presence in the community and a loyal customer base.Our team thrives in a supportive, diverse, fast‑paced, and fun work environment wh...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Delivery Driver - Sign Up in Minutes

Delivery Driver - Sign Up in Minutes

DoorDash • BRACKENDALE, British Columbia, CA
Temps plein
Available in over 100 cities in Canada, DoorDash connects local businesses and local drivers (called Dashers) with opportunities to earn, work, and live.All you need is a mode of transportation (bi...Voir plus
Dernière mise à jour : il y a 8 jours • Offre sponsorisée
Earn money testing apps - Remote

Earn money testing apps - Remote

Almedia • Delta, British Columbia, Canada
Télétravail
Temps plein
Get paid for testing apps, games and surveys.Almedia runs a dynamic platform where users earn money online by completing tasks, playing games, and filling out surveys.Since our launch 5 years ago, ...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
Tech Expert & Electronics Advisor

Tech Expert & Electronics Advisor

London Drugs • Squamish
Temps plein
A leading Canadian retail chain is seeking a TECH Specialist in Squamish to assist customers with Computers, Audio Visual Equipment, Mobile Phones, and more.As a specialist, you will provide advice...Voir plus
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ée